Hey guys! Are you gearing up for the SECFPSE exam and feeling a bit overwhelmed? Don't worry, you're not alone! The IP Kaplan SECFPSE (Security Engineering Certified Practitioner for Software Engineers) certification is a valuable credential for anyone looking to bolster their skills in software security. But, let's be real, the exam can seem daunting. That's where a solid review, like the one offered by IP Kaplan, comes into play. This comprehensive IP Kaplan SECFPSE essential review is designed to break down the key areas you need to know, providing you with a roadmap to success. We'll delve into the nitty-gritty, covering everything from secure coding principles to threat modeling and vulnerability analysis. This isn't just a generic overview; we're diving deep to give you the edge you need to ace the exam and excel in your security career. We will cover all the crucial aspects, ensuring you're well-prepared and confident on exam day. Buckle up, because we're about to embark on a journey through the essential elements of the IP Kaplan SECFPSE review! This is your ultimate guide, designed to provide clarity, confidence, and a clear path to certification. Remember, preparation is key, and with this review, you're taking a significant step towards achieving your goals. Let's get started!

    What is the SECFPSE Certification? Understanding the Basics

    Alright, before we jump into the IP Kaplan SECFPSE essential review, let's make sure we're all on the same page about what this certification actually is. The SECFPSE certification, offered by (ISC)², is specifically targeted towards software engineers and developers. It's designed to validate your knowledge and skills in designing, developing, and deploying secure software. Think of it as a stamp of approval that says, "Hey, this person knows how to build secure applications." This is super important because, in today's digital landscape, security is paramount. Software vulnerabilities are a major cause of data breaches, financial losses, and reputational damage. By earning the SECFPSE, you demonstrate your commitment to building security into the software development lifecycle from the very beginning. Unlike some certifications that focus on general security concepts, the SECFPSE dives deep into the practical application of security principles within the context of software engineering. The certification covers a wide range of topics, including secure coding practices, security testing, threat modeling, vulnerability management, and secure software design. This comprehensive approach ensures that certified professionals possess a well-rounded understanding of the security challenges and best practices in the software development world. This is not just a certification; it's a testament to your ability to build secure software, protect sensitive data, and mitigate risks. It's a valuable asset in today's increasingly complex and threat-filled digital environment, and it is a testament to your capability in building more safe software that can defend the safety of critical data. By holding this certification, you position yourself as a leader in the field of secure software development, showcasing your dedication to building secure and reliable applications. In essence, the SECFPSE is about empowering software engineers to become security champions. It equips you with the knowledge and skills to proactively address security concerns throughout the software development lifecycle.

    Why Choose IP Kaplan for Your SECFPSE Preparation?

    So, you've decided to go for the SECFPSE? Awesome! Now, the next question is: How are you going to prepare? This is where IP Kaplan comes in. IP Kaplan is a well-respected name in the world of IT training, known for its comprehensive and effective exam preparation materials. They offer a range of resources specifically designed to help you ace the SECFPSE exam. Their materials are meticulously crafted and cover all the key domains of the exam. The IP Kaplan SECFPSE preparation materials are designed to provide a comprehensive and effective learning experience, covering all the essential domains of the exam. They provide structured courses, practice exams, and other valuable resources that are designed to help you not just learn the material but also pass the exam. They offer structured courses, practice exams, and other valuable resources. Their instructors are experienced professionals who are experts in their fields. The materials provided are designed to be easily understandable, even if you are not from a security background. They have a proven track record of helping candidates succeed. One of the biggest advantages of using IP Kaplan is their focus on exam-specific preparation. They understand the format and content of the SECFPSE exam inside and out. Their materials are tailored to help you tackle the questions and scenarios you'll encounter on exam day. They offer a structured approach to learning, with clear explanations, practical examples, and plenty of opportunities to test your knowledge. IP Kaplan provides a well-organized curriculum, with modules that align with the exam's domains. This structure makes it easier to stay on track and ensure you're covering all the necessary material. IP Kaplan's practice exams are particularly valuable. They simulate the actual exam environment, allowing you to get comfortable with the question formats, time constraints, and overall exam experience. They also offer detailed feedback on your performance, helping you identify your weak areas and focus your studies. When choosing a training provider, it's crucial to assess their experience and reputation. IP Kaplan's long history in the IT training industry speaks volumes about their expertise. They have a proven track record of helping candidates succeed in various IT certifications, and their SECFPSE preparation materials are no exception.

    Core Domains Covered in the IP Kaplan SECFPSE Review

    Alright, let's get into the meat and potatoes of the IP Kaplan SECFPSE essential review. This section breaks down the core domains that the exam covers. IP Kaplan's review materials are structured around these domains, ensuring you get a comprehensive understanding of each topic. These domains are the cornerstones of secure software development. Understanding them is crucial, and IP Kaplan provides you with the tools you need to succeed. The SECFPSE exam covers a broad range of security topics, which are typically organized into several key domains. This domain-based approach helps to ensure a comprehensive assessment of a candidate's knowledge and skills across various aspects of secure software development. Here's a breakdown of the core domains you'll encounter in the IP Kaplan review and on the exam itself.

    1. Secure Software Design

    This domain focuses on the principles and practices of designing secure software systems from the ground up. This involves understanding threat modeling, security architecture, and secure design patterns. You'll learn how to identify potential threats and vulnerabilities and how to design your software to mitigate those risks. Key topics include: security requirements gathering, threat modeling methodologies (STRIDE, DREAD, etc.), architectural patterns for security (e.g., defense in depth), and secure design principles (e.g., least privilege, fail securely). IP Kaplan's review covers these topics in detail, providing you with practical examples and case studies. This domain is all about building secure systems from the foundation up, and it's essential for any software engineer serious about security. This helps you build robust and resilient applications. You'll get to analyze how security requirements can be integrated from the beginning, including threat modeling to anticipate risks. Secure design principles, such as least privilege, are also explored to guide development. The goal is to construct a solid, secure base for your software.

    2. Secure Coding Practices

    This is where the rubber meets the road. This domain dives into the specific coding techniques and best practices that help prevent vulnerabilities in your code. The knowledge and implementation of the best coding practices are very important. Think about secure coding principles, input validation, output encoding, and handling sensitive data. This is where you'll learn how to write code that's resistant to common attacks like SQL injection, cross-site scripting (XSS), and buffer overflows. Key topics include: secure coding standards (e.g., OWASP, SANS), input validation and output encoding techniques, handling sensitive data securely, and preventing common coding vulnerabilities (SQL injection, XSS, CSRF, etc.). IP Kaplan's review provides hands-on exercises and real-world examples to help you master these techniques. Mastering secure coding practices is crucial to building secure applications. IP Kaplan offers comprehensive coverage of secure coding standards, including OWASP and SANS, ensuring you're up to date with the latest best practices. Input validation and output encoding are emphasized, which are fundamental in preventing common vulnerabilities like SQL injection and XSS. Understanding how to handle sensitive data securely is also a critical part of the domain. By focusing on these principles, you will be able to write more robust and resilient applications.

    3. Security Testing and Analysis

    Once you've built your software, you need to test it to ensure it's secure. This domain covers various testing techniques, including static analysis, dynamic analysis, and penetration testing. You'll learn how to identify vulnerabilities and assess the overall security posture of your software. Key topics include: static code analysis, dynamic application security testing (DAST), penetration testing methodologies, vulnerability assessment, and security testing automation. IP Kaplan's review provides guidance on selecting the right testing tools and techniques for your specific needs. This domain provides the skills to identify vulnerabilities in your software. Static code analysis is covered, showing you how to find security flaws by reviewing the code without executing it. Dynamic application security testing is another key area, where you learn to assess security during runtime. Penetration testing methodologies are also detailed, equipping you with practical strategies to assess software security. Security testing automation is also included to optimize efficiency and effectiveness. This domain ensures that you have the skills to test the security of your applications effectively.

    4. Software Development Security Lifecycle (SDLC)

    This domain emphasizes integrating security into every phase of the software development lifecycle. From planning to deployment and maintenance, you'll learn how to incorporate security best practices throughout the entire process. Key topics include: integrating security into each phase of the SDLC (requirements, design, implementation, testing, deployment, and maintenance), security governance, risk management, and compliance considerations. IP Kaplan's review helps you understand how to build a secure development process from start to finish. This domain emphasizes how security considerations must be integrated into every phase of the SDLC, from the initial planning stages to deployment and maintenance. It gives you a roadmap for incorporating security best practices throughout the entire development process. You will learn about security governance, risk management, and compliance considerations, ensuring a holistic approach to software security. This domain ensures you build more secure and robust applications.

    5. Security Operations and Incident Response

    Even with the best security practices, incidents can happen. This domain covers the operational aspects of security, including incident response, vulnerability management, and security monitoring. You'll learn how to detect, respond to, and recover from security incidents effectively. Key topics include: incident detection and response procedures, vulnerability management and patching, security monitoring and logging, and disaster recovery planning. IP Kaplan's review provides insights into the tools and techniques used in security operations. This domain ensures you can detect, respond to, and recover from security incidents effectively. You'll learn about incident detection and response procedures and how to handle security breaches when they occur. Vulnerability management and patching are also critical. You will learn how to monitor systems for potential threats and vulnerabilities. Disaster recovery planning ensures you are prepared to deal with any situation. This ensures you can handle security incidents that may occur. The importance of proactive monitoring is also discussed, ensuring you can detect potential threats early.

    Mastering the IP Kaplan SECFPSE Exam: Tips and Strategies

    Okay, now that you know what's covered, let's talk about how to actually conquer the exam! Here are some tried-and-true tips and strategies to help you succeed. Remember, preparation is key, but so is knowing how to take the test. Mastering the IP Kaplan SECFPSE exam requires not only a strong grasp of the technical concepts but also effective test-taking strategies. Here are some key tips to guide you through the process.

    1. Plan Your Study Schedule

    This might seem obvious, but it's crucial. Create a realistic study schedule and stick to it. Break down the material into manageable chunks and allocate time for each domain. Use the IP Kaplan review materials to guide your studies, and don't be afraid to adjust your schedule as needed. A well-structured plan helps you stay on track and avoid cramming. Take note of how much time you need to study, create a realistic schedule, and stick to it.

    2. Utilize IP Kaplan's Practice Exams

    Practice, practice, practice! IP Kaplan's practice exams are invaluable. They simulate the exam environment, help you identify your weak areas, and build your confidence. Take them under exam conditions (timed, no distractions) to get the most out of them. Take practice tests under exam conditions to simulate the real experience.

    3. Review Your Weak Areas

    Don't just take practice exams and move on. After each practice exam, carefully review your answers. Identify the areas where you struggled and focus your studies on those topics. IP Kaplan's materials offer detailed explanations and examples to help you understand the concepts. Focus on the areas where you are struggling, and go back to the material.

    4. Understand the Exam Format

    Get familiar with the exam format. Know how many questions there are, the time limit, and the types of questions you'll encounter. IP Kaplan's materials will provide you with all this information. This will help reduce test anxiety.

    5. Stay Calm and Focused

    On exam day, stay calm and focused. Read each question carefully and don't rush. If you're unsure of an answer, eliminate the options you know are incorrect. Pace yourself and manage your time effectively. Don't panic if you get a question wrong; move on and come back to it later if you have time. Take your time, read each question carefully, and focus.

    Final Thoughts: Your Path to SECFPSE Success

    Alright, guys, you've got this! The IP Kaplan SECFPSE essential review is a powerful tool to help you ace the exam and launch your career in secure software engineering. By studying the core domains, utilizing the provided resources, and following the tips and strategies outlined above, you'll be well on your way to earning your SECFPSE certification. Remember, this is an investment in your future. The skills and knowledge you gain will not only help you pass the exam but will also make you a more valuable asset to any organization. The SECFPSE certification will open doors to exciting career opportunities and contribute to your overall professional development. Good luck with your studies, and I hope to see you celebrating your success soon! You are now prepared to start your journey towards achieving the SECFPSE certification. Your dedication, coupled with the resources from IP Kaplan, is the perfect combination for success. Keep practicing, stay focused, and believe in yourself. The future is secure! The certification will not only enhance your career but also provide you with the tools to excel in today's digital landscape. Your commitment to secure software development will significantly enhance your skills and your profile.